概括
麻醉科医生必须预测PCI后进行非心脏手术的高风险患者的静脉栓塞. 当标准方法失败时,静脉-体外膜氧化 (VA-ECMO) 提供了一个有前途的治疗方法.

背景情况:
- 接受非心脏手术的穿皮冠状动脉干预 (PCI) 患者面临风险.
- 静脉栓塞是这些高风险个体中可能发生的关键并发症.
研究的目的:
- 突出在接受非心脏手术的患者中管理静脉栓塞的挑战.
- 将VA-ECMO作为耐火病例的潜在治疗选择.
主要方法:
- 对涉及PCI的高风险手术患者的临床情景的审查.
- 讨论用于静脉栓塞的治疗算法.
- 评估VA-ECMO作为一个救援疗法.
主要成果:
- 静脉栓塞可以耐常规治疗和心肺复苏.
- 在危急情况下,VA-ECMO显示出作为有效的救援疗法的潜力.
结论:
- 在非心脏手术期间,麻醉科医生必须对高风险PCI患者的静脉栓塞保持警.
- VA-ECMO代表了一种有价值的治疗选择,用于管理对标准干预不反应的危及生命的静脉栓塞.
